How accurate are these Candy Crush Jelly Saga vs MONOPOLY: The Board Game revenue estimates? v
Directional - typically within 2-3× of actual money earned for popular apps. The $500.7K for Candy Crush Jelly Saga and $3.66M for MONOPOLY: The Board Game are derived from App Store grossing rank, scraped IAP tiers, ratings volume and category benchmarks (Games) - net of the 15-30% Apple/Google store cut. Real revenue depends on country mix, retention, refunds and ad fill rate, none of which Apple or Google publish.
